SENCO - Independent School in Reading - April Start!
A well-established independent school in Reading is seeking an experienced and compassionate SENCO to join the school on a full-time, permanent basis, starting April. This is a key role within the school, supporting pupils with additional needs in a calm, well-resourced environment with small class sizes and strong pastoral care.
The school places a clear emphasis on inclusion, individual support, and pupil wellbeing, making this an excellent opportunity for a SENCO who values personalised education and collaborative working.
The Role
Leading and overseeing SEND provision across the school
Managing EHCP processes, reviews, and statutory requirements
Coordinating interventions and tailored support for pupils with additional needs
Working closely with teaching staff, senior leaders, parents, and external agencies
Advising and supporting staff on inclusive classroom practice
Monitoring pupil progress and contributing to whole-school development
The Ideal Candidate Will Have
Qualified Teacher Status (QTS)
NASENCO qualification (or willingness to complete if not already held)
Experience supporting pupils with SEND in a school setting
Strong knowledge of SEND legislation and EHCP processes
Excellent communication and organisational skills
A calm, professional, and pupil-focused approach
